>I have a single column grid in which I've added a container housing a few controls (labels and textboxes). I've set the column's CurrentControl to be the new container.
>
>The container's Anchor is set to 15 and the textboxes within it also have the same value for their anchor. When I resize the grid column, I don't see the textboxes dimensions changing as I'd expect.
>
>Has anyone tried to do this and if so, did it work for you? Is my expectation not something that VFP can accomplish using anchors?
>
>Regards,
>Mike

VFP doesn't propagate column resize.

try
* Column.Resize event
this.Controls[2].Move(0,0,m.this.width,this.parent.RowHeight)
